The generalized Kondo lattice where even number of localized electrons are coupled with two conduction bands is investigated using the dynamical mean-field theory combined with continuous-time quantum Monte Carlo method. The crystalline electric field (CEF) singlet-triplet states are taken for localized states. With one conduction electron per site, a staggered order with Kondo and CEF singlets arises. Nature of the electronic order is studied in terms of the local susceptibility. The effective CEF splitting in one sublattice remains almost the same as the original CEF splitting, while the other sublattice looks like Kondo singlets. Hence, this electronic order is interpreted as alternating sites of itinerant and localized singlet states. © Published under licence by IOP Publishing Ltd.
